Equity Research Report on Pharma Licensing and Royalties

Equity Research Report on Pharma Licensing and Royalties

May 13, 2026 | By GenRPT Finance

Pharma licensing and royalty agreements have become major drivers of company valuation in the healthcare sector because pharmaceutical firms increasingly depend on partnerships, intellectual property monetization, and shared commercialization strategies to expand revenue opportunities. In many healthcare companies, licensing income and royalty streams contribute significantly to long term financial forecasting, Equity Valuation, and future cash flow stability.

This is why pharma licensing and royalties have become important focus areas in equity research, investment research, and equity analysis. Investment analysts, portfolio managers, and asset managers closely monitor licensing agreements because they can reshape future revenue projections, operational risk exposure, and long term profitability expectations.

For firms producing equity research reports, evaluating licensing and royalty models requires combining Financial modeling, risk analysis, market trends, and strategic business evaluation into one investment framework. Modern equity research automation and ai for data analysis systems are also helping investment analysts process financial reports, analyst reports, audit reports, and healthcare market data much faster than traditional workflows.

Why Licensing and Royalties Matter in Equity Research

Licensing agreements allow pharmaceutical companies to expand product reach, reduce operational burden, and generate recurring income without fully managing commercialization independently.

Royalty structures can improve:

  • Revenue projections
  • Financial forecasting
  • Equity performance
  • Enterprise Value
  • Market positioning
  • Financial transparency

At the same time, poorly structured agreements may increase:

  • Equity risk
  • Financial risk assessment concerns
  • Operational dependency
  • Profit margin pressure

This is why financial advisors, wealth managers, and financial consultants carefully evaluate royalty structures and licensing strategies while making investment strategy recommendations.

Understanding Pharma Licensing Models

Pharma licensing agreements usually involve one company granting another company rights related to product development, commercialization, manufacturing, or geographic distribution.

Common licensing structures include:

  • Regional licensing agreements
  • Co-commercialization partnerships
  • Revenue sharing models
  • Intellectual property licensing
  • Manufacturing partnerships

For investment analysts, these agreements are important because they directly influence long term cash flow expectations and Equity Valuation.

Companies with strong licensing networks often reduce commercialization risk while improving operational scalability.

How Equity Research Teams Evaluate Royalty Models

Investment research teams analyze royalty structures using operational and financial indicators.

Revenue Stability

One of the first areas analysts evaluate is recurring royalty income stability.

Investment analysts study:

  • Long term licensing contracts
  • Revenue sharing percentages
  • Geographic exposure
  • Product diversification
  • Partner quality
  • Commercial scalability

Recurring royalty streams may improve financial forecasting reliability because they create stable long term income opportunities.

Margin Analysis

Royalty based business models often generate higher operational margins compared to full commercialization strategies because companies may avoid large manufacturing and distribution expenses.

This may improve:

  • Profitability Analysis
  • Enterprise Value
  • Financial transparency
  • Long term equity performance

However, excessive dependency on licensing partners may also increase operational concentration risk.

Why Licensing Deals Influence Stock Prices

Licensing announcements often create strong stock price reactions because investors view partnerships as signals of future commercial potential.

Strong licensing agreements may improve:

  • Investor confidence
  • Equity performance
  • Market Sentiment Analysis
  • Revenue projections
  • Financial forecasting expectations

Weak licensing structures or failed partnerships may increase:

  • Equity risk
  • Liquidity analysis pressure
  • Financial risk mitigation concerns
  • Long term growth uncertainty

This is why investment analysts closely monitor management commentary and strategic partnership announcements.

The Role of AI in Licensing and Royalty Analysis

AI for Equity Research is becoming increasingly important in pharmaceutical licensing analysis because healthcare firms generate large amounts of operational and financial data.

Traditional research workflows required analysts to manually review:

  • Financial reports
  • Analyst reports
  • Audit reports
  • Licensing agreements
  • Market research
  • Management presentations

Today, ai for data analysis systems can process large datasets much faster.

Modern equity research automation platforms support:

  • Trend analysis
  • Financial forecasting
  • Portfolio risk assessment
  • Market Sentiment Analysis
  • Equity search automation
  • Competitive benchmarking

AI report generator systems also help investment analysts identify changes in licensing strategies, operational priorities, and revenue concentration trends.

For example, ai for equity research tools can compare royalty models, partnership structures, and commercialization performance across pharmaceutical companies.

This improves portfolio insights for asset managers and portfolio managers.

Financial Modeling in Licensing Valuation

Financial modeling plays a major role in evaluating pharmaceutical licensing agreements because royalty income often extends across long time horizons.

Investment analysts usually evaluate:

  • Revenue projections
  • Royalty percentages
  • Market penetration assumptions
  • Geographic expansion opportunities
  • Cost structures
  • Long term profitability

Sensitivity analysis becomes especially important because small changes in royalty assumptions may significantly affect Equity Valuation.

For example, increasing expected market penetration for a licensed product may substantially improve Enterprise Value calculations.

Geographic Exposure and Partnership Risk

Geographic exposure strongly influences licensing valuation models.

Pharmaceutical firms operating globally face challenges related to:

  • Regulatory environments
  • Pricing controls
  • Currency volatility
  • Distribution infrastructure
  • Political uncertainty

Emerging Markets Analysis is becoming increasingly important because healthcare demand continues rising across developing economies.

However, international partnerships may also increase operational complexity and financial risk assessment concerns.

Geopolitical factors may significantly affect financial forecasting assumptions for multinational healthcare companies.

Patent Protection and Licensing Value

Patent protection remains one of the strongest drivers of licensing and royalty value.

Strong intellectual property protection supports:

  • Pricing power
  • Revenue stability
  • Competitive advantage
  • Long term market positioning
  • Financial transparency

Weak patent protection may reduce royalty income potential because competition often increases rapidly after exclusivity periods weaken.

This is why investment analysts carefully monitor intellectual property timelines while preparing equity research reports.

Scenario Analysis in Licensing Valuation

Scenario Analysis is widely used in pharmaceutical licensing valuation because healthcare businesses operate within changing market conditions.

Research teams generally create multiple future outlook scenarios.

Positive Scenario

The licensing partnership strengthens market positioning, revenue growth, and profitability.

Neutral Scenario

The company maintains stable royalty income and operational performance.

Negative Scenario

Weak commercialization performance, operational inefficiencies, or partnership disputes reduce future growth expectations.

Sensitivity analysis is then applied to estimate the impact on:

  • Revenue projections
  • Equity performance
  • Equity market outlook
  • Liquidity analysis
  • Financial forecasting
  • Cost of capital

This helps investment analysts prepare for multiple future outcomes.

Corporate Governance and Strategic Partnerships

Strong governance frameworks improve partnership management and investor confidence.

Companies with strong governance systems generally maintain:

  • Better capital allocation
  • Financial transparency
  • Stable risk assessment frameworks
  • Disciplined investment strategy execution

Weak governance structures may increase financial risk mitigation concerns and negatively affect Equity Valuation.

This is why wealth managers and portfolio managers carefully evaluate leadership quality and operational discipline while assessing licensing focused healthcare firms.

Long Term Investment Opportunities in Licensing Models

Pharma licensing models continue creating long term investment opportunities because healthcare companies increasingly prefer collaborative commercialization strategies.

Experienced investment analysts often look for companies with:

  • Strong licensing portfolios
  • Diversified royalty streams
  • Competitive intellectual property
  • Sustainable Financial modeling assumptions
  • Effective partnership management

This supports long term value investing opportunities across pharmaceutical markets.

Conclusion

Pharma licensing and royalty agreements play a major role in evaluating pharmaceutical company value, investor confidence, and long term equity performance. For firms involved in equity research, investment research, and financial research, licensing valuation has become an important part of healthcare sector analysis.

Modern ai for data analysis platforms, equity research automation systems, and financial research tool solutions are helping investment analysts process licensing related data faster while improving portfolio insights and financial forecasting accuracy.

However, successful equity analysis still depends heavily on combining Financial modeling, fundamental analysis, scenario analysis, and strategic business understanding.

Platforms like GenRPT Finance are helping investment analysts, portfolio managers, wealth managers, and financial advisors streamline healthcare equity research through AI-driven financial research, automated reporting, and smarter investment insights generation.

FAQs

Why are pharma licensing agreements important in equity research?

Licensing agreements influence revenue growth, operational scalability, company valuation, and long term profitability expectations.

How do royalty models affect pharmaceutical valuation?

Royalty models create recurring revenue opportunities that may improve financial forecasting stability and long term cash flow visibility.

How does AI improve licensing analysis?

AI improves equity research automation by processing financial reports, licensing agreements, and market data faster than manual workflows.

Why is patent protection important in royalty valuation?

Patent protection supports pricing power, revenue stability, and long term licensing value.

What is scenario analysis in licensing valuation?

Scenario Analysis evaluates multiple future business outcomes to estimate how partnership performance and market conditions may affect valuation.